The problem with tga strains in general, from what i hear, is they don't stabilize their lines, so with all the polyhybrid breading, there are so many phenotypes of each "strain," some good, some not so much. the Wendell Its a plushberry x moonwreck, though I'd love to see it crossed with the BMR. The Nigerian, Durban and VRK are all BMR crosses and they're pretty heady.
I'm running his pennywise strain which is supposed to have four pheno's and only one is the one you want 11-12%THC:11-12%CBD. I got 5 regular seeds for $60 at their registered dealer locally and two didn't germinate while I lucked out with a fem for this one. still got two seeds left but that's a lot of money for something you probably won't get. didn't know all that when I bought them but fingers crossed! on their website, tga says in bold print that it is "super pest and PM resistant" where the other strains he has say it too but never used the word "super" to describe it and never in bold print. thought it would do great out by me and so she's outdoors and has grown from 1.5ft to 6 ft in about a month and a half. all I do is give her water and shes planted in the earth.
